Your new role
As a Senior Environmental Consultant, you will play a pivotal role in the planning and delivery of environmental services for major infrastructure projects, particularly within the transport sector. You will be responsible for leading environmental assessments, including the preparation of scoping reports, Environmental Impact Assessments (EIAs), and other technical documentation.
You’ll work closely with multidisciplinary teams—such as highways, drainage, geotechnical, and structural engineers—to ensure environmental considerations are integrated into project design and delivery. Your expertise will span a wide range of environmental topics including biodiversity, landscape and visual impact, cultural heritage, climate change, waste and materials, and population and human health.
Key aspects of your role will include:
- Project Leadership: Managing environmental inputs across multiple projects, ensuring timely and high-quality delivery.
- Technical Oversight: Reviewing and authoring environmental reports and assessments in line with UK legislation and industry standards.
- Stakeholder Engagement: Liaising with statutory bodies such as Natural England, the Environment Agency, and local authorities to support project approvals and compliance.
- Team Development: Line managing junior consultants, providing mentoring and technical guidance to support their growth.
- Site Work: Conducting site visits and inspections to inform environmental design and mitigation strategies.
- Business Development: Supporting bid preparation and contributing to the growth of the environmental team through forecasting and client engagement.
This role offers the opportunity to influence the environmental outcomes of nationally significant infrastructure projects while developing your leadership and technical expertise in a supportive and forward-thinking environment.
What you'll need to succeed
- A degree in Environmental Science or a related field.
- At least 6 years’ experience in environmental consultancy.
- Strong knowledge of DMRB topics and UK environmental legislation.
- Experience managing environmental inputs for infrastructure projects.
- Excellent communication and stakeholder engagement skills.
- Membership of a relevant professional body (or working towards it).
